.NET中的共享配置文件
发布时间:2020-05-24 15:03:21 所属栏目:asp.Net 来源:互联网
导读:我有一个包含Web和 Windows NT服务应用程序的解决方案.这些当然是两个不同的项目,但在同一个解决方案中.然而,他们分享了许多相同的配置. 目前,我在web.config和app.config文件中都有相同的值.这开始变得混乱,我想为解决方案中的两个应用程序提供共享配置文件.
|
我有一个包含Web和 Windows NT服务应用程序的解决方案.这些当然是两个不同的项目,但在同一个解决方案中.然而,他们分享了许多相同的配置. 目前,我在web.config和app.config文件中都有相同的值.这开始变得混乱,我想为解决方案中的两个应用程序提供共享配置文件. >网络是否存在问题 解决方法好吧,您可以将配置的某些部分“外部化”为单独的.config文件,并在两个地方使用它们.例如.您可以外部化您的连接字符串设置,如下所示: <connectionStrings configSource="connectionStrings.config" /> 然后有这样的“connectionString.config”文件: <?xml version="1.0" encoding="utf-8"?>
<connectionStrings>
<add name="ConfigurationDatabase"
connectionString="server=.;Integrated Security=true;database=test"/>
<add name="TestDatabase"
connectionString="server=TEST;Integrated Security=true;database=test"/>
</connectionStrings>
基本上,任何ConfigurationSection都有这样的“configSource”设置,允许您指定要使用的外部文件. 这样,您就可以共享两个配置文件的公共部分. 渣 (编辑:安卓应用网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|
相关内容
- 如何配置IIS 7以使用子目录作为默认文档?
- ASP.net – 多个上传与jQuery多文件上传插件
- asp.net – web配置错误:无法识别的属性’xmlns:xdt’.请
- asp.net – 仅在本地IIS服务器上支持创建虚拟目录
- asp.net-mvc – ASP.Net MVC捆绑和分类
- asp.net-mvc-4 – 后退点击刷新页面 – MVC 4
- 为什么用户信息存储在ASP.NET的默认成员资格提供者的两个不
- asp.net-mvc – MVC3 Url.Action查询字符串生成
- 发布ASP.NET vNext / DNX与CLR类库结合使用
- asp.net – Azure上的联合身份验证
推荐文章
站长推荐
- asp.net-mvc – 无法加载文件或程序集’Microsof
- ASP.NET MVC下Ajax.BeginForm方式无刷新提交表单
- asp.net-mvc – 我需要在我的所有页面上使用`[Va
- asp.net-mvc – ASP.NET MVC:从控制器返回CDN图
- ASP.Net核心 – 获取帖子表格的所有数据
- asp.net – Glass Mapper打破了图像字段的标准值
- asp.net-mvc – Asp.net MVC授权属性,重定向到自
- asp.net-mvc-3 – 如何在.NET MVC3中注入用于验证
- asp.net-web-api – 在Web Api / Owin架构中,处理
- asp.net-mvc – 将JSON格式的DateTime传递给ASP.
热点阅读
